What you’ll be doing
You will be responsible for the planning, monitoring, controlling, and forecasting of the business unit budget, creating systems and new controls to achieve the department financial goals with the aim of improving costs will be part of your challenges. You will work close to the finance department ensuring accuracy in the functions maintaining high levels of communication with the business unit operations and ensuring reports are accurate and in a timely manner. You will be responsible for the preparation of financial reports, ad hoc analyses, and mon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ements.
A day as a Business Unit Controller
- Commercial contact and sparring partner for management
- Reporting accurately and timely P&L, forecasting and departmental KPIs including appropriate commentary
- Monitoring the course of the business while reporting deviations or risks to the management board
- Preparation of sales, cost and personnel budgets and forecasts in coordination with management and operation
- Responsible for monthly, quarterly and annual financial statements
- Creation of deviation analyses, budgets, forecasts and ad-hoc analyses
- Involved in the operation, collecting data, and setting up measures of controls to improve revenue and cost of the business unit.
- Integrating with other departments including operational departments to understand the true bases of efficiency and unit synergies
- Checking that Business unit reports are fed in accurately and on time and be confident to challenge the integrity of data where appropriate
- Supporting the creation, set up and development of new reporting tools and processes to assist the global finance integration of the group
